Articles

How to set table cellpadding and cellspacing using CSS?

How to set table cellpadding and cellspacing using CSS?

This is a valid way to produce the same effect as table’s cellpadding attribute. The style rules in the following example will add 10 pixels of padding to the table cells. Similarly, you can use the CSS border-spacing property to apply the spacing between the adjacent table cell borders, like cellspacing attribute.

Is there a way to eliminate cellspacing in a table?

If you’re trying to eliminate cellspacing (that is, cellspacing=”0″) then border-collapse:collapse should have the same effect: no space between table cells. This support is buggy, though, as it does not override an existing cellspacing HTML attribute on the table element.

How do you add padding to a table in CSS?

The style rules in the following example will add 10 pixels of padding to the table cells. Similarly, you can use the CSS border-spacing property to apply the spacing between the adjacent table cell borders, like cellspacing attribute.

What’s the alternative for cell padding in CSS?

The CSS alternative for cellpadding would be: td { padding: 10px; } This applies a 10 pixel padding to the cell.

What does forget about table cellspacing in HTML do?

Sharing is caring! What does Forget About Table Cellspacing In HTML (And Learn The CSS Now) do? Was used to specify the distance between the individual cells of an HTML table. This element has been deprecated and CSS should be used to control table layout. The cellspacing attribute was used to control the amount of space between cells of a table.

Can you use cellpadding and cellspacing in Internet Explorer?

E.g. for 10px of “cellspacing”: This property will even allow separate horizontal and vertical spacing, something you couldn’t do with old-school “cellspacing”. This will work in almost all popular browsers except for Internet Explorer up through Internet Explorer 7, where you’re almost out of luck.

What’s the default spacing for cells in CSS?

This applies spacing of 10 pixels to cells in the table. Remember that the default value for cellpadding is 0 (padding: 0px) and the same applies to cellspacing (border-collapse: collapse). By setting the cellspacing the border-collapse property is now set to separate rather than collapse.

How does the cellpadding property work in JavaScript?

Sets or retrieves the amount of space between the border of the cells in a table. Use the cellPadding property if you want to set the space between the border and contents of the cell. You can find the related objects in the Supported by objects section below. This property is read/write. Sets or retrieves the amount of space between cells.

What’s the difference between cellpadding and cellspacing?

1 Cellpadding: Cellpadding specifies the space between the border of a table cell and its contents (i.e) it defines the… 2 Cellspacing: Cellspacing specifies the space between cells (i.e) it defines the whitespace between the edges of the… More

Is the cellpadding and cellspacing attribute deprecated in HTML?

Since cellpadding and cellspacing attribute on HTML has been deprecated on HTML5. We need another alternative for padding and spacing of cells. So, In this section we will be using border-spacing to CSS property which allows of cellspacing on table.